Executive Administrative Assistant to the President

The Executive Administrative Assistant to the President provides high-level administrative, organizational, and operational support to the President of the College. This individual serves as a trusted partner and key liaison between the Office of the President and internal and external constituencies, ensuring the President’s time and priorities are managed effectively. The successful candidate will demonstrate exceptional judgment, discretion, professionalism, and a deep commitment to the mission and values of a small, selective liberal arts college.

This role is a full-time, hourly position with a starting wage range of $21.64 to $26.45 per hour.

1. Executive Support

  • Manage the President’s calendar, appointments, and travel arrangements with accuracy and foresight.
  • Prepare briefing materials, correspondence, reports, and presentations for meetings, events, and internal and external engagements.
  • Anticipate and proactively address scheduling conflicts, communications needs, and follow-up actions.
  • Handle sensitive and confidential information with discretion and professionalism.

2. Board and Institutional Support

  • Coordinate logistics and materials for meetings of the Board of Trustees and its committees in collaboration with the Vice President for Development and Alumni Engagement and other members of the Senior Staff.
  • Prepare agendas, compile board books, and track follow-up items as assigned.

3. Communications and Liaison

  • Serve as the first point of contact for the Office of the President, providing a professional and welcoming presence for visitors and callers.
  • Communicate effectively on behalf of the President with faculty, staff, students, trustees, alumni, and other external stakeholders.
  • Draft, proofread, and edit correspondence, memos, and official communications.
  • Collaborate closely with the offices of Development, Academic Affairs, Student Life, Athletics, Human Resources, Finance, and others to ensure alignment across institutional priorities, and on-going communications to ensure the President’s Office has the needed information about events and guests.
  • Demonstrate an appreciation for and sensitivity to an inclusive academic community, fostering a welcoming environment for students, faculty, and staff from all social, economic, cultural, ideological, racial, and ethnic backgrounds.

4. Event and Project Coordination

  • Assist in planning and executing presidential events, including campus receptions, special visits, and community gatherings.
  • Support special projects and initiatives as assigned, often involving cross-campus collaboration.
  • Employ project management systems to track progress, manage timelines, and support institutional initiatives under the direction of the President.

5. Office Management

  • Oversee the reservations for conference rooms in Old Centre and guest cottages.
  • Prepare monthly billings for guest cottages.
  • Manage and reconcile budgets related to the Office of the President, including procurement / travel cards, event expenses, and travel reimbursements.
  • Supervise student worker(s).

Required:

  • Bachelor’s degree or equ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• Minimum of five years of progressively responsible administrative experience, preferably in higher education or a similarly complex organization.
  • Demonstrated ability to handle confidential information with discretion.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ills, with strong attention to detail and accuracy.
  • Exceptional organizational and time management skills, with the 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ced environment.
  • Proven ability to exercise independent judgment and maintain professionalism in interactions with diverse stakeholders.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Outlook) and comfort with digital collaboration tools (Google Workspace, Zoom, Microsoft Teams, etc.).

Preferred:

  • Experience supporting a senior executive, board, or president in a higher education or nonprofit setting.
  • Familiarity with the culture, mission, and operations of a liberal arts college.
  • Event planning and project management experience.

Key Attributes

  • Discretion, diplomacy, and integrity in all interactions.
  • Collegiality and commitment to teamwork.
  • Initiative, adaptability, and sound judgment.
  • Warmth, professionalism, and a service-oriented mindset.
  • Alignment with the College’s mission of academic excellence, community, and student-centered education.

Physical Requirements

  • Limited pushing, pulling, lifting. Lifting would not exceed 20 lbs.
  • Mobility on campus necessary. Ability to stand for extended periods of time.
  • Visual acuity to read computer screens and reports.
  • Ability to work nights and weekends, as necessary.
